Quick specs to check

  • Capacity: Ranges from 12 oz to 30 oz
  • Mouth ID/OD: Typically 70–90 mm
  • Base diameter: Fits most cup holders at ~73–75 mm
  • Lid type: Straw, flip, or screw-on
  • Materials: Stainless steel, plastic, glass
  • Dishwasher guidance: Top-rack safe or hand-wash recommended

How to Choose

Capacity is key when selecting drinkware. It determines how much liquid you can carry, which is essential for meeting hydration needs. For instance, a larger capacity may be ideal for long commutes or outdoor activities, while a smaller size may suffice for short trips.

Materials significantly affect the durability and safety of the drinkware. Stainless steel is often chosen for its longevity and ability to keep drinks at consistent temperatures. For those concerned about weight, plastic options might be more suitable.

Insulation plays a crucial role in temperature retention. Double-walled designs can help keep drinks hot or cold for extended periods, making them perfect for long workdays or travel.

Lid type impacts usability and spill prevention. A screw-on lid may provide a secure seal, while a flip or straw lid offers convenience during active use, such as driving or exercising.

Ergonomics ensure comfort in handling and drinking. Features like a non-slip grip or a handle can make a tumbler more user-friendly, particularly for those with smaller hands or limited mobility.

Fit within cup holders and bags is important for portability. Consider the base diameter and shape to ensure it suits your daily travel and storage needs.

Safety & Setup

When dealing with hot liquids, use caution to avoid burns, and check that lids are securely fastened. Always wash new drinkware before first use to remove any manufacturing residues. For dishwasher safety, verify the manufacturer’s recommendations, as not all materials are dishwasher-friendly. Avoid sealing carbonated drinks tightly, as pressure buildup can pose risks. Ensure that any drinkware intended for children is appropriately labeled as safe for their use.

Core Pillars

Temperature Retention: High-quality insulation helps maintain drink temperatures, whether hot or cold, for several hours. This can enhance your drinking experience, especially during long commutes or outdoor activities.

Leak Control: A secure seal minimizes spills and leaks, crucial for preventing messes in bags or cars. Look for reliable lid designs that ensure a tight closure.

Ergonomics: Comfort in use is essential, especially for prolonged holding. Features like textured grips and handles can enhance ease of use.

Sustainability: Opting for reusable drinkware supports environmental efforts by reducing single-use plastic waste, aligning with eco-friendly practices.

Care & Maintenance

Regular maintenance extends the life of your drinkware. Perform daily rinses and weekly deep cleaning with a mild detergent. Check gaskets for wear to ensure seals remain effective. Store drinkware with the lid off to prevent odors, and replace any damaged parts as needed to maintain performance.

Comparison with Alternatives

Tumblers, bottles, and travel mugs each offer distinct benefits. Tumblers are versatile for both hot and cold drinks, while bottles often focus on portability and spill prevention. Travel mugs are designed for optimal heat retention and are ideal for coffee lovers. Consider your primary use case to determine which option best suits your needs.
